Sports News


NFL Boxscore

Philadelphia VS Atlanta
December 6, 2009
Sunday, December 6, 2009
Final1234 Score
Philadelphia103147 34
Atlanta0007 7
Wrap
Scoring Summary
First Quarter
Philadelphia Field Goal - 33-yarder by David Akers.
Philadelphia Touchdown - 4-yard pass from Donovan McNabb to Leonard Weaver. (David Akers extra point is good).
Second Quarter
Philadelphia Field Goal - 33-yarder by David Akers.
Third Quarter
Philadelphia Touchdown - 5-yard run by Michael Vick. (David Akers extra point is good).
Philadelphia Touchdown - 83-yard interception return by Sheldon Brown. (David Akers extra point is good).
Fourth Quarter
Philadelphia Touchdown - 5-yard pass from Michael Vick to Brent Celek. (David Akers extra point is good).
Atlanta Touchdown - 2-yard pass from Chris Redman to Roddy White. (Matt Bryant extra point is good).
